- Morning city tour: Our tourguide and driver will pick you up and discovery the busthling Ho Chi Minh city. • Saigon Notre Dame Cathedral • Saigon Central Post Office • War Remnants Museum • Independence Palace – historic symbol of reunification • Tan Dinh Church – the famous “Pink Church” • Jade Emperor Pagoda – beautiful Taoist/Buddhist temple We go back to the hotel around 1 pm. - Afternoon Motobike food tour This afternoon, local guide and riders will take you around the city by motorbike. 1. A traditional unknown Vietnamese food 2. The Secret Weapon Cellar where VC stored their weapons in the heart of Sài Gòn to attack the Independent Palace 3. The oldest apartment – Vietnamese local dessert 4. The biggest flower market 5. The 75-years-old Vietnamese coffee 6. The China Town – with 300-years-old temple 7. Beef stew - Tour end and our guide and driver take you back to your hote

Ho Chi Minh City, also known as Saigon and long considered as the Pearl of the Far East, is the most dizzying city of commerce and culture in Vietnam. A visit to Saigon is like an encounter with exotic delicious food, French colonial architecture and memories of Vietnam War.
